#8b6a48 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b6a48 is composed of 54.5% red, 41.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.8% and a lightness of 41.4%. #8b6a48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d490 with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#8b6a48 color description : Dark moderate orange.

#8b6a48 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b6a48 has RGB values of R:139, G:106,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.48,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9136712.

Shades and Tints of #8b6a48

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0705 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b6a48

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6a68 is the less saturated color, while #cc6b07 is the most saturated one.
